Ingersoll Rand 8038-E 250RPM Electrode Dresser. Brand: Ingersoll Rand Product Type: Tool Electrode Capacity: 5/16” Diameter to 1-1/2” Diameter Recommended Hose Size: 5/16” I.D. Speed: 250RPM Notes: Electric Dresser Weight: 5.5lbs
Maintain consistent, high-quality welds while minimizing production downtime with the Ingersoll Rand 8038-E 250RPM Electrode Dresser. Engineered to recondition spot welding electrode tips quickly and efficiently, this tool significantly extends electrode life and ensures optimal contact for every weld. By restoring the original geometry of worn tips, it promotes uniform current flow and reduces energy waste during the welding process.
The Ingersoll Rand 8038-E 250RPM Electrode Dresser is designed for portability and ease of use. Its compact form factor allows for simple handling in tight spaces or on-the-go reconditioning at multiple weld stations. Precision cutting blades restore the exact profile of the electrode tip in seconds, making the tool ideal for high-cycle manufacturing environments. With each reconditioning cycle, it helps reduce the frequency of electrode replacements, lowering maintenance costs and increasing throughput.
Ideal for use in automotive assembly, metal fabrication, appliance production, and other high-volume manufacturing lines, the Ingersoll Rand 8038-E 250RPM Electrode Dresser plays a critical role in preventative maintenance programs. It is especially effective in operations where automated or robotic welding cells rely on consistent electrode performance. By preserving tip shape and conductivity, this tool ensures cleaner welds, reduced scrap rates, and greater overall equipment effectiveness (OEE).
